Subject: 23.0.90; Missing definition for the function 'rmail-insert-rmail-file-header'
Date: Tue, 17 Feb 2009 21:25:27 -0500
I have installed the Emacs for Windows provided by Jason Rumney at
http://alpha.gnu.org/gnu/emacs/pretest/windows/.

While reading the newsgroup gnu.emacs.bug using gnus, I attempted to
save a message using the function 'gnus-summary-save-article' (defined
in gnus-sum.el), which is bound to the key 'o' in the summary buffer.
After prompting me for a location, gnus issues the following error
message:

  "Autoloading failed to define function rmail-insert-rmail-file-header"

I have searched the elisp files included in emacs 23.0.90.1's 'lisp'
directory tree (all subdirectories), but have not been able to find a
definition for the function 'rmail-insert-rmail-file-header'.  The
only references to the function are in gnus/gnus-util.el and
gnus/gnus.el.
